Gabrielle Arrizza
Artist Biography
Gabrielle has lived in Calgary most of her life, initially emigrating from Italy. Being rooted in European culture and living in Canada have given her a bi-cultural context and have equally contributed to her self-identity. The push and pull of two cultures have been constant in her life and have developed a unique critical perspective of both. Gabrielle is currently completing a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ree with a major in Visual Studies at the University of Calgary.
Patterns of Singapore
In my artistic journey, I strive to bridge the representational and the abstract. By deconstructing organic and human made forms and patterns, I combine what I see and what is hidden to create ambiguity between the familiar and unknown. Taking everyday objects and landscapes out of context and re-imagining them in abstract compositions helps me view and represent my surroundings in unique ways. I am a multi-disciplinary artist and enjoy combining various media to explore the interplay and layering effects they create.
